		<description>I went over here today around 12:45 - the line was out the door.  The sandwiches coming out looked great and they had a sandwich special that featured crab.  I only got dessert - an iced coffee (made with fresh brewed espresso!!!!!!) and some macarons (lemon &amp; pistachio). This is my first time trying macarons, so I wasn&#039;t sure they&#039;d meet the hype, but they really did.  They hit all the senses - the colors are fanciful, they are wonderfully fragrant, and have a thin crispy shell that gives in an almost spongey cookie inside.  The lemon is a real explosion of lemon flavor, while the pistachio was more subtle.  I&#039;m absolutely in love with these cookies.</description>
